GPS Active Antenna Specifications (Recommendation)

Frequency:

1575.42 + 2MHz

Amplifier Gain:

18~22dB Typical

Axial Ratio:

3 dB Typical

Output VSWR:

2.0 Max.

Output Impedance: 50Ω

Noise Figure:

2.0 dB Max

Polarization:

RHCP

Antenna Input Voltage: 3.3V (Typ.)


NOTE:
1. RESET: Low Active, when EB-5318RF is accepted this single, EB-5318RF going to Hibernate

mode. If want EB-5318RF up, need input ON_OFF single.

2. TIMEMARK: One pulse per second output. When EB-5318RF is 3D Fixed, this pin will output

1uS Hi level pulse. If don’t use this, just NC.

3. ECLK: ECLK clock input for frequency aiding applications or as a test clock. If don’t use this,

just NC.

4. GPIO: User can use this I/O pin for special functions. For example, control LED, and can be

used External Interrupts. If don’t use this, just NC.

5. WAKE_UP: EB-5318RF power on, WAKE_UP will output 1.8V.
6. ON_OFF: This pin is controlled EB-5318RF power on. If EB-5318RF want to EB-365 pin to pin

compactable, please ON_OFF connect to WAKE_UP. If don’t use this, just NC.

7. DR I2C interface: The I2C interface supports required sensor instruments such as gyros,

accelerometers, compasses or other sensors that can operate with an I2C bus. If don’t use
this, just NC.

8. VBAT: This is the battery backup power input for the SRAM and RTC when main power is

removed. VBAT is 2V ~ 3.5V.
